Transaction 2342998be99b832e44b720fc0cc4738c22d70703f439d149d2e69cb586fa1976
2 Input
2 Outputs
- 2342998be99b832e44b720fc0cc4738c22d70703f439d149d2e69cb586fa1976:0
- 2342998be99b832e44b720fc0cc4738c22d70703f439d149d2e69cb586fa1976:1
value 10065
address 15qeg5F7eZ2VJovvDWfWFUs4vKrfWK2nkG
value 191271
address 14Rmzjz1XDwowYkgc8n9ojPSf98ytsFBJQ